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_017738.4(CNTLN):c.309G>T(p.Gln103His) variant causes a missense change. The variant allele was found at a frequency of 0.0000238 in 1,599,450 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CNTLN (HGNC:23432): (centlein) Enables protein domain specific binding activity; protein kinase binding activity; and protein-macromolecule adaptor activity. Involved in centriole-centriole cohesion and protein localization to organelle. Located in cytosol; microtubule organizing center; and nucleoplasm.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Sep 09, 2024 | The c.309G>T (p.Q103H) alteration is located in exon 1 (coding exon 1) of the CNTLN gene. This alteration results from a G to T substitution at nucleotide position 309, causing the glutamine (Q) at amino acid position 103 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
